TOYOTA QUANTUM BUS EXTERIOR OVERVIEW

The overall impression of the exterior of the Toyota Quantum Bus is one of sophistication. Most notable is the semi-bonnet design, which gives the Quantum a polished feel. It is done with intention, as the design allows more space in the interior of the vehicle. The exterior design has also allowed more legroom (a 90mm increase in fact) to enhance the comfort of passengers.

The Daytime Running Lights are also positioned to heighten the driver's visibility on the road. It is great to see that regardless of the stylish aesthetics, Toyota never forgets one key element: Safety. Visibility rears its head again with the power-retractable side mirrors. The model also rests on newly assembled 16” alloy wheels, which reinforce the vehicle’s presence on the road.

This range is available in two colours: Ivory White and Quicksilver Metallic.

As elegant as the interior of the Toyota Quantum Bus is, it was assembled purely for comfort and safety. Passengers can now enjoy additional legroom and headroom. Toyota has also adorned the cabin with interesting patterns and shapes, which give an overall impression of travelling through space.

Depending on the variant chosen, motorists can choose between a blend of fabric and synthetic leather seats. Toyota has made several adjustments to heighten visibility within the cabin. This is most apparent with the lowered front side mirrors and the addition of an auxiliary mirror. A standout feature is the electrochromatic rear-view mirror and the reverse camera.

Toyota enthusiasts will be familiar with the Apple CarPlay and Android Auto functionality, which allow the motorist to sync their smartphone with the vehicle itself.

TOYOTA QUANTUM BUS INDIVIDUAL INTERIOR AND EXTERIOR OPTIONS

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B bus 11-seater GL

The first model in our range is the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B bus 11-seater GL. This model is equipped with 130kW of power and 11 seats.

Exterior features:Black front bumper, black rear bumper
Interior features:Cupholders, electrochromatic rearview mirror

Toyota Quantum 2.8 SLWB bus 14-seater GL

The second model in the range is the Toyota Quantum 2.8 SLWB bus 14-seater GL. This model comes standard with 115kW of power and 14 seats.

Exterior features:Colour front grille, black door outside handles
Interior features:Reverse camera, fabric seat trim

Toyota Quantum 2.8 14-seater GL A/T

Next in our range is the Toyota Quantum 2.8 14-seater GL A/T. This model comes equipped with 115kW of power and 14 seats.

Exterior features:Halogen headlights, LED Daytime Running Lights
Interior features:Multi-information display, hydraulic power steering

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B VX Bus 6s

The fourth model in our range is the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B VX Bus 6s. This model comes standard with 115kW of power and 6 seats.

Exterior features:Bulb Daytime Running Lights, Headlamp levelling
Interior features:Air conditioner, Bluetooth/USB

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B bus 9-seater VX

The last model in our range is the Toyota Quantum 2.8 LWB bus 9-seater VX. This model comes standard with 115kW of power and 9 seats.

Exterior features:Rear lights (bulb type), mudguards
Interior features:Toyota Connect, Apple CarPlay & Android Auto

TOYOTA QUANTUM BUS FAQS

What is the total number of seats available in the Quantum Bus?

This is dependent on the variant that the consumer chooses. The largest bus available is a 14-seater.

Does the Toyota Quantum run on petrol?

The new range uses diesel for fuel purposes.

Is the Toyota Quantum suitable for a family?

Absolutely. The space available in a Quantum makes it ideal for families.

What does the term gd6 mean?

The term GD-6 stands for “Global Diesel”.

Is the Toyota Quantum only available as a minibus taxi?

Not at all. The Quantum is also available as a panel van.
